Options
All
  • Public
  • Public/Protected
  • All
Menu

Hierarchy

  • OCCTVertex

Index

Constructors

constructor

  • new OCCTVertex(occWorkerManager: OCCTWorkerManager): OCCTVertex
  • Parameters

    • occWorkerManager: OCCTWorkerManager

    Returns OCCTVertex

Methods

getVertices

  • Get all vertices in the list of a shape

    group

    get

    shortname

    get vertices from shape

    drawable

    true

    Parameters

    Returns Promise<TopoDSVertexPointer[]>

    OpenCascade vertices

getVerticesAsPoints

  • Get all vertices in the list of a shape as points

    group

    get

    shortname

    get vertices as points

    drawable

    true

    Parameters

    Returns Promise<Point3[]>

    Points

vertexFromPoint

  • Creates vertex shape from point

    group

    from

    shortname

    vertex from point

    drawable

    true

    Parameters

    Returns Promise<TopoDSVertexPointer>

    OpenCascade vertex

vertexToPoint

  • Transform vertex to point

    group

    transform

    shortname

    vertex to point

    drawable

    true

    Parameters

    Returns Promise<Point3>

    Point

verticesCompoundFromPoints

  • Creates compound shape containing multiple vertices. This simply speeds up rendering and allows to apply occt transformations easily on vertex groups.

    group

    from

    shortname

    compound vertices from points

    drawable

    true

    Parameters

    Returns Promise<TopoDSCompoundPointer>

    OpenCascade vertices as compound shape

verticesFromPoints

  • Creates vertices from points

    group

    from

    shortname

    vertices from points

    drawable

    true

    Parameters

    Returns Promise<TopoDSVertexPointer[]>

    OpenCascade vertices

verticesToPoints

  • Transforms vertices to points

    group

    transform

    shortname

    vertices to points

    drawable

    true

    Parameters

    Returns Promise<Point3[]>

    Points

Generated using TypeDoc